I was warmly welcomed by the staff of Pastamania when I entered and ushered to my seat. Didn't quite expect such a warm reception, but I felt it was a nice touch. After taking a look at their menu I decided to try their risotto instead of their usual pasta items. I had their Prawns and Mussels Risotto ($10.50) which is essentially prawns, mussels & arborio rice cooked with homemade broth, tomato sauce and parmesan cheese. When I received my dish, I was a little taken aback by the small portion of rice. I wished they could be more generous, nonetheless it managed to fill me up as it was starchy rice with lots of cheese. I actually liked the hint of tomato in the risotto sauce, which explain the slight reddish hue of the rice, however, the rice in my opinion was not soft enough and it could have been stewed a little longer to absorb more flavour from their risotto broth.
